Official abstract text for this publication.
The present invention relates to a process to produce compounds of the formula (1) which are suitable for use in electronic devices, as well as to intermediate compounds of formula (Int-1) and compounds of formula (1-1) and (1-2) obtained via the process. These compounds are particularly suitable for use organic electroluminescent devices. The present invention also relate to electronic devices, which comprise these compounds.
